Tried freeze dried tubiflex cubes or frozen bloodworms? If they wont nibble on whole cubes, then let them soak in the tank a little bit, then rip them appart and rub them between your fingers. This makes the cube release all the worms. My loaches (and all my fish) loved it when tubiflex rained down ...
